Abstract

The importance of science writing is emphasized in the 2015 revision curriculum. Various teaching materials should be developed to encourage students to express themselves more creatively. Therefore, the purpose of this study is to develop teaching-learning materials for the class of writing at high schools based on the 2015 revision curriculum. The teaching-learning materials were developed based on the key concepts and sections of 『Life Science I』 under the revised curriculum in 2015. Prior to this, we analyzed materials suggesting scientific writing in eight types of textbooks, including 2015 revision 『Life Science I』. The analytical framework was divided into descriptive and demonstrative formats, which were subdivided into nine formats. The analysis results showed that the most explained forms of science writing were presented in descriptive form, and among the analytical framework, the most descriptive sub-categories of task resolution, causal presentation. Based on the analysis results, the 2015 revision to the section of 『Life Science I』 Life Sciences Ito present various forms of science writing was developed. We hope developed materials will be utilized for practical learning, so that students can use them as Life Science writing materials for creative problem solving. Future research is expected to produce a suitable science writing and learning material in junior high school 『Science』 along with 『Life Science II』 textbooks.
